  • Synthesis of the 4-chlorobenzoylthiourea compound was carried out by acylating thiourea with 4-chlorobenzoyl chloride. The 4-chlorobenzoylthiourea compound will increase the lipophilic and the electronic properties other than the lead compounds of benzoyl thiourea in order to, by expectation, raise the central nervous system depressant as well. The lipophilic would affect the ability of the compounds in penetrating biological membranes, which is highly dependent on the solubility of the drug within lipid/water. Log Pis the most common method used in determining the parameter value. This experiment was to mix two dissolvents ( octanol and water) which are immissible. The both levels of the compounds were carefully observed by a spectrophotometer UV-Vis. From the test, the result of log P value ofthe 4-chlorobenzoylthiourea compound was 2.32, while the theoretical log P value of the compounds, by using then Hansch-Fujita method is 1.62 and the fRekker-Mannhold method is 2.225. Consequently, the result of the test shows that there is a significant difference between the progress experiment and both theoretical log P methods. Moreover, in the test of the central nervous system depressant through the potentiation test to thiopental using mice indicates that the 4-chlorobenzoylthiourea compound have potentiation effects to thiopental compared to the lead compounds ofbenzoylthiourea.
